What companies run services between Norwich, England and Crown Court, Luton, England?

You can take a train from Norwich to Crown Court via London Liverpool Street, Liverpool Street station, Farringdon station, Farringdon, and Luton in around 2h 50m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Norwich to Luton DART Parkway every 4 hours. Tickets cost £11–20 and the journey takes 3h 10m.
